For decades, offshore competitors won primarily on labor cost. Mid-sized plants competed by squeezing margins, extending lead times, or accepting complexity as unavoidable.
That equation is breaking.
Between 2025 and 2030, competitive advantage will shift away from the lowest hourly wage and toward speed of understanding, decision quality, and operational adaptability. This is where AI gives mid-sized plants a durable edge.
Why Offshore Advantages Are Eroding
Offshore manufacturing still offers labor arbitrage, but it increasingly carries hidden costs.
These include:
Long and fragile supply chains
Limited responsiveness to demand changes
Slower engineering feedback loops
Higher coordination overhead
Greater exposure to geopolitical, regulatory, and logistics risk
As variability increases, distance becomes a liability.
The New Competitive Battlefield: Decision Speed
Mid-sized plants rarely beat offshore competitors on scale. They win by making better decisions faster.
Key advantages include:
Proximity to customers
Faster engineering-to-production feedback
Tighter coordination across teams
Greater flexibility in execution
AI amplifies these strengths when it is applied correctly.

Why AI Makes Localization Economically Viable
Historically, local manufacturing was more expensive.
AI changes the math by:
Reducing scrap and rework
Improving utilization
Lowering expediting and firefighting
Increasing first-pass yield
Protecting margin
These gains close the cost gap while preserving responsiveness.
